The central thesis of Hold Me Tight is simple: We need a "secure base" to return to. When you snap at your partner or shut down emotionally, you aren't being mean or crazy; you are experiencing Attachment Panic .

Johnson argues that most arguments (about money, dishes, or the kids) are actually fights about emotional disconnection. The question beneath every fight is: Are you there for me?
